How do we reduce carbon emissions?
Optimization of energy grids
Dalsia designs energy-efficient heat transfer grids that minimize energy losses, reducing the need for additional resources and fuels.
Highly efficient subscriber stations
Our district heating substations Dalsia floXY, Dalsia fleXY, Dalsia flexTherm, and Dalsia flexCool use modern heat exchangers and intelligent control algorithms to ensure optimal energy consumption.
Integration of renewable energy sources
The use of solar energy, geothermal sources, biomass, and waste heat reduces dependence on fossil fuels and consequently lowers CO₂ emissions.
SCADA monitoring and energy management system SiDiO wise energy
Through our intelligent monitoring and management system SiDiO, clients can optimize the operation of their heating and cooling systems in real-time, achieving lower energy consumption and fewer emissions.
Energy-efficient components
The components offered by Dalsia – heat exchangers, thermostatic valves, smart water meters, smart heat meters, pre-insulated pipes – are designed to reduce heat losses and improve overall system efficiency.
